This handy python script gets links of a show from Discovery. You can also specify a season with -s
and an episode with -e
.
The resulting information will be saved in an Excel file.
- DMAX.de (dmaxde, default)
- de.hgtv.com (hgtv)
- TLC.de (tlcde)
Specify the shortcode ("realm") with -r
.
- Clone repo
pip install -U -r requirements.txt
- NOTE: On Linux you may have to call
pip3
because the normal pip will use Python 2
- NOTE: On Linux you may have to call
python dmax.py SHOWID [-s SEASON] [-e EPISODE] [-r REALM]
- NOTE: Same as above - you may need to call
python3
under Linux. This script WON'T work with Python 2! - To get the show id, navigate to the page of the series you want to download, press CTRL+U to open the page source and search for "showid". It's inside a
<hyoga-player>
HTML tag. - For realms, see the supported sites above. Default is DMAX.de.
- NOTE: Same as above - you may need to call
- Check help with
python dmax.py -h
- Contacts Discovery API to get tokens and show + video data
- Sends token and video id(s) to the player API which returns the link(s)